Does cursing mean intelligence?

Swearing is actually a sign of verbal superiority according to recent studies. Timothy Jay, a professor of psychology at the Massachusetts College of Liberal Arts has been studying swearing for more than four decades. He says new research indicates swearing is a sign of intelligence and it’s also a sign of honesty.

Are people who swear unintelligent?

Researchers from Southern Connecticut State University have found that using bad language leaves a negative impression on others, even those who are not offended by profanity. According to the analysis, people who swear are perceived as being unintelligent, untrustworthy, and less likeable.

Are people who curse smarter?

People Who Curse Are Smarter Than People Who Don’t. The study’s researchers took 43 college students, ages 18 to 22, and asked them to recite as many swear words as they could in one minute and name as many animals as they could in one minute, the Huffington Post reports. The people who could name more swear words could also name more animals,…

Are people who swear more intelligent?

Research published last year from the University of Rochester found that the more people swear, the more intelligent they are likely to be. When combined with the latest research, this suggests that although intelligent people may swear more, they are then seen by others as less intelligent.
